| Country | Plastic surgery board | Verification method |
|---|---|---|
| Colombia | SCCP (Sociedad Colombiana de Cirugía Plástica) | Direct SCCP registry lookup |
| Mexico | Consejo Mexicano de Cirugía Plástica | National council registry |
| Brazil | SBCP (Sociedade Brasileira de Cirurgia Plástica) | SBCP member directory |
| Costa Rica | Costa Rican College of Physicians and Surgeons specialty registry | National college verification |
Why this verification step is identical in importance everywhere
Every country on this list has real, meaningful board certification systems — and every country also has providers who advertise heavily without holding that certification. The verification step is the same regardless of destination: identify the specific national board for your procedure type, then check directly rather than trusting a clinic's own claim.
Beyond plastic surgery specifically
Non-cosmetic specialties (cardiac, orthopedic, general surgery) have their own separate national boards in each country — don't assume plastic-surgery-specific verification steps apply to other specialties.
